TOXIC: A FAIRY TALE FOR GROWN-UPS is a new Kannada-language Indian film that I went and saw at the multiplex on opening day last week. I’d been waiting for it since they played the trailer before RZA’s ONE SPOON OF CHOCOLATE and I felt like I’d seen God. I think it already left that theater, but maybe you can find it in your area, so I want to get the word out. I’m a TOXIC crusader.

I was already sold on the movie when I learned that American martial arts legend J.J. “Loco” Perry (competitor in BLOODSPORT III, choreographer of UNDISPUTED II) is one of the action directors. That makes it an event in my book. You might wonder why he’d want to go overseas to work behind the scenes after graduating to director with DAY SHIFT, THE KILLER’S GAME and AFTERBURN, but this was an opportunity he couldn’t turn down. In a Q&A at Big Bad Film Fest recently (as heard on Action for Everyone), he said that UNDISPUTED II was shot in 30 days, all the movies he’s directed were 42, Chad Stahelski’s upcoming HIGHLANDER was 125, but TOXIC was 225! It’s one of the most expensive movies ever made in India, and taking a whipping in their media for not making the money back. But ACAB includes armchair studio accountants, so I will break with those pigs and thank the producers for investing so much in my entertainment.

TOXIC is an operatic, ultra-maximalist gangster action movie co-written, produced and starring (in a dual role) a superstar called Yash, credited as “Rocking Star Yash.” That it’s directed and co-written by a woman, the former actress Geetu Mohandas, adds an interesting layer to its depiction of masculinity, which is so over the top there’s simply no chance we’ll ever be able to locate the top again.
